Celebrate summer any time and wherever you are through the flavors of 100 island recipes and stunning, immersive photographs from America's summer home destination. Seven miles off the coast of Massachusetts, this charming island is home to over one hundred restaurants and cafes, fifty farms, six bakeries, five fish markets, three coffee roasters, two breweries, and one (very popular) farmers' market. It is a world-class cooking and eating destination, with something new and exciting to discover around every corner. This cookbook is an edible tour across the island's six towns, with signature appetizers, entrées, desserts, and drinks from each locale. Start the day with warm Cranberry Maple Oat Scones, then transport yourself to the seaside with Brown Butter Lobster Rolls, Roasted Clams with Hot Sauce Butter, and Bloody Mary Tuna with a side of Corn and Heirloom Tomato Salad with Honey Herb Vinaigrette. Cool off with an Agricultural Fair-favorite Espresso Floater while exploring the island through the eyes of summer residents and well-loved locals who share their dream itineraries in the Seven Perfect Days spreads. This is the perfect gift for Vineyarders, vacationers, or anyone wanting a taste of glorious summer--wherever or whenever.
